Prince Harry, the second son of Prince Charles and the late Princess Diana, will formally introduce his Zimbabwean fiancee to Queen Elizabeth for the first time early next week, sources said on Thursday.
The 23-year-old Prince Harry will use the wedding of his cousin, Peter Phillips, son of Princess Anne (Prince Charles’ junior sister), to introduce Chelsy Davy, 22.
Chelsy has met Prince Charles and his current wife Carmilla Parker-Bowl (the Duchess of Cornwall) on many occasions.
But Prince Harry’s communications team, say “an introduction to the Queen is considered a significant step up the social ladder for a potential princess”.
The couple have been dating on and off for almost four years. For much of that period, Chelsy was based in South Africa, but last year she moved to Leeds, North-eastern England, where she is currently studying for a post-graduate law degree, while being closer to Harry.
Harry’s decision to introduce her to the Queen despite controversy about her (Chelsy) father’s links with Zimbabwean Robert Mugabe, is a sign of how seriously he takes the relationship, said one royal analyst.
Chelsy’s multi-millionaire father, Charles Davy, has been a business partner in a Safari company with Webster Shamu, a leading politician in Mugabe’s ZANU-PF government.
He is one of the few white landowners in the Southern African nation not to have been badly affected by the Mugabe land grabs virus.
